Output 17990d81a39b1255e176d0f2242af4fa02299a7090af608fcba9df7a21fd66ae:2

value
91965813
script pubkey
OP_HASH160 OP_PUSHBYTES_20 593ba1e111e23f888b5782d1ea78d6dea2495e2b OP_EQUAL
address
39pqVwiwjJXdT5sRV7knauVeTBV9bNVjhY
transaction
17990d81a39b1255e176d0f2242af4fa02299a7090af608fcba9df7a21fd66ae
spent
true